In a recent discussion, Diego Sanchez, President of HousingWire, engaged with Chris Vinson, the CEO of Windsor Mortgage, a division of Plains Commerce Bank, to delve into the notable advancements that have propelled Windsor’s growth within the competitive mortgage lending landscape. Vinson elaborated on the company’s strategic emphasis on wholesale lending, which has allowed it to harness partnerships with mortgage brokers to expand its market reach. This approach not only enhances the firm’s versatility in catering to diverse borrower needs, but also solidifies its position as a key player within the wholesale space. Windsor’s success can be attributed to its ability to foster beneficial relationships while implementing best practices that elevate client satisfaction and operational efficiency.
In addition to its wholesale focus, Vinson highlighted the company’s commitment to integrating cutting-edge technology into its operations, which has significantly streamlined processes and improved overall user experience. By adopting innovative technologies, Windsor Mortgage is well-positioned to remain agile and responsive to industry changes and borrower demands. Furthermore, the organization prioritizes coaching and development for its team members, ensuring that staff remain equipped with the necessary skills to navigate the ever-evolving mortgage market. This emphasis on professional growth not only enhances employee engagement but also translates into superior service for clients navigating their home financing journeys.
**Key Points:**
– **Wholesale Lending Focus**: Windsor Mortgage has prioritized wholesale lending to expand market reach and enhance client relationships.
– **Technology Integration**: The company leverages advanced technology to streamline operations and improve user experience across the lending process.
– **Coaching and Development**: Windsor emphasizes ongoing coaching for its employees, fostering professional growth that ultimately benefits customer service.
